Water Pollution Reduction by Using New Premetalated Dyes in Dyeing Wool

Abstract: This study shows the dyeing behaviour and impact over the wastewaters quality resulted from dyeing wool fibres, of a new synthesized premetalated dyes, derived from new acid dye, sodium(E)-2-((1-amino-4-sulphonatonaphthalen-2-yl)diazenyl)-6methoxybenzo[d]thiazole-5 or 7-sulphonate, as a result of interaction with Ni(II) and Zn(II) ions.
